发明名称 Harmonic cavity resonator
摘要 Cavity resonators have a multitude of applications in radio-frequency, microwave, and vacuum electronics. Cavity resonators are used as frequency selective filters and oscillators. In vacuum electronic devices and charged particle accelerators cavities are used to couple energy into and out of charged particle beams. Typically cavity resonators are optimized for single mode operation and are limited to sinusoidal waveforms and interactions. Harmonic cavities have many of the same applications, but because they resonate many axially symmetric harmonic modes simultaneously, the superposition of these modes is an on-axis arbitrary waveform. Harmonic cavities have both passive and active applications. When a periodic charged particle beam passes through a harmonic cavity whose resonances are at the same frequency as the beam's periodicity, the beam induces these cavity modes to resonate. The superposition of these modes, on axis, has a voltage vs. time waveform that ideally mirrors the current vs. time of the beam that induced it. Harmonic cavities can also be used to apply arbitrary waveforms to charged particle beams when driven externally. These waveforms can be used to modulate, shape, and accelerate the beam. A harmonic cavity whose axis is tilted to the beamline can be used to change the trajectory of selected particle bunches by delivering them fast kicking pulses.

主权项 1. A cavity resonator comprising: a. A conductive enclosure with a predetermined saucer shape that has many axially symmetric transverse magnetic modes with harmonic resonant frequencies, b. means to exchange energy with the cavity resonator, c. a plurality of radial slits in said conductive enclosure, whereby exclusively resonating said many axially symmetric harmonic modes.
